Sync ER1 and KP and Serge and Buchla

Published on Dec 20, 2013 pjoris2·123 videos

"Syncing everything to the Korg ER-1.

Again: ER1 triggers bass notes on the Kilpatrick (see previous video). Actual notes come from a sequencer on the Serge (with quantizer and ASR). Some trigger delay also using slope generators on the Serge. Actual bass-sounds are only Kilpatrick (oscillators and filter).

Midi thru on the Kilpatrick midi-to-cv convertor then goes to the K4816 on the Buchla which receives midi clock from the ER-1.

A bit messy and busy, but a nice test."

Liine's Lemur Half off for the Holidays

iTunes: Lemur - Liine

If you've held off due to the relatively high price of the app, now is likely the time to pick it up.  It's a deal considering the original hardware from Jazz Mutant was over $1500.


"For a limited time over the holidays, Lemur is on sale. Grab it while you can and build the controller setup of your dreams! MIDI/OSC, scripting, cabled or wireless, it's all possible now at half the cost! Sale is going on from December 20 2013 up to January 19 2014. Happy holidays to everybody!

Lemur is the world's best MIDI/OSC controller for iOS. Benefiting from nearly 10 years of development, Lemur is synonymous with multitouch music control. All these major artists can't be wrong: Daft Punk. Björk. Nine Inch Nails, Deadmau5. M.I.A., Justice, Hot Chip, Orbital, Richie Hawtin, The Glitch Mob, Matthew Herbert, Joris Voorn, Stephan Bodzin, Modeselektor, Alva Noto, Richard Devine, Gui Boratto ... you?

Lemur now features an In App Editor and Skins. LiveControl 2, the ultimate Ableton Live controller, will be available as free download in early 2013.

In App Editor — Lemur has evolved. Design your templates on the fly, without a computer in sight. The In-App Editor, available on iPad only, makes multitouch control truly improvisatory by letting you shape your controller the same way you shape sounds. Virtually every function of the desktop editor application is now available through an intuitive system of iOS menus and widgets. Best of all – it’s easier to use than ever. This means a much smaller learning curve and an immediate initial experience. Any basic configuration, such as a typical bank of faders, can now be created with a few familiar taps and gestures. And any factory template can be adjusted quickly to suit your particular needs.

Skins — Lemur now features three new skins, in addition to the classic look. Choose the look that fits your style and get inspired.

LiveControl 2 — Experience the ultimate Ableton Live controller, designed in partnership with master designer ST8. Improvise a riff on the Play page, then switch to the Sequencer page to edit the pattern. Choose a key and scale to guide your melodies and use Quick Chord to instantly create harmonies. Use the Modulate page to flawlessly map any parameter from any plugin to the MultiBall object and take advantage of Physics, LFOs and gesture recording. The Launch page gives you everything you would expect from a clip launcher, and more. We even integrated snapshots and morphing.

Richard Devine & TRASH_AUDIO's Top 10 Modules of 2013 and a Very Nice Pic!


via Richard Devine on Facebook

"Had a lot of folks ask me what my top 10 list of Eurorack modules are for 2013, so here it is:

1. Intellijel - Shapeshifter
2. Modcan Quad LFO
3. Mutable Instruments - Braids
4. Macro Machines - Memory Manager (for the Mungo d0/g0)
5. Audio Damage Freqshift / Grain Shift
6. Intellijel - Metropolis sequencer
7. TipTop - Trigger Riot
8. Harvestman Piston Honda MK II
9. Antimatter Audio - Brain Seed
10. Livewire - Choas Computer
11. Malekko Heavy Industry - MegaWave

Link here for the complete list with videos at Trash Audio — with @intellijel, Danjel van Tijn and @Livewire Electronics."
